Nintendo today confirmed the previous rumors that the company will debut its successor to the Wii console at this year's E3 Expo, to be held in Los Angeles, CA June 7 through June 9, 2011.
While the Wii has easily been the most successful of this generation of consoles, due in part to its family-friendly and more casual design than the hardcore Xbox 360 and PlayStation 3 competitors, it's seen a slump in sales in recent years.
And Nintendo is not about to let their industry lead die out. The next generation offered by Nintendo will indeed be revealed at E3 in June, and it will also be playable. The company intends to share more details on the system at the expo as well, no doubt during their press conference before the show floor opens.
The new system has also been confirmed to have a release date during the 2012 year. Nintendo has not included its sales in the forecasts for the fiscal term ending March 2012, however, meaning we probably won't see the system until the holiday season next year.
